Episode Summary
In this episode, we explore four major developments in the AI landscape—from enterprise innovation to hardware breakthroughs. Cognizant accelerates its AI momentum with new patents, award-winning research, and a platform to scale autonomous agents. Collibra takes a strategic leap into unstructured data governance through the acquisition of Deasy Labs. Microsoft bets big on Southeast Asia, launching its first AI research lab in Singapore to localize innovation. And Hailo Technologies introduces the Hailo-10H, a groundbreaking chip bringing generative AI to the edge.
